I can’t believe its been a month!!  One month ago my stomach was partially removed and left behind the new stomach the size of a golf ball elongated into a sleeve.  Hence the name gastric sleeve.  Two months ago I weighed 385 lbs!

Now there are two things.  One good and one bad.  I’ll start with the bad.  And when I say bad I mean sucks.  So my scale here at home is not so accurate.  For that I am bummed.  When I weighed in today at the doctor’s office I weighed in at 333 lbs.  I was a little upset.  Kinda sucked.  But oh well.  I still am losing loads.  The doctor and the dietitian are both really excited about my weight lose and think that I have done a great job!

The good news is NO MORE PUREED FOOD!!  I CAN HAVE NORMAL FOOD AGAIN!!  What was my first act of normalcy?  Red Robin’s Whiskey River Chicken Roll Up.  So freaking good!!  Oh and I had two fries.  No I couldn’t eat it all.  I have a few bites with the wrap then had to take the meat out.  The rest got packed up and was my afternoon snack and my dinner later.  My taste buds are still celebrating!

So, still losing.  Just not as much as I thought but that’s okay.  I am wearing clothes that I haven’t worn before.  I am feeling great and have loads of energy.  Getting a wicked tan.  And according to my husband, I don’t snore anymore.
